I have a Lexmark P3150 All in one Printer (got it for free from a friend) and I downloaded the drivers from the lexmark website..and suddenly i realize..its not compatable with Windows Vista (which my laptop has), its only compatable with windows xp. I've read a couple of complaints from the lexmark website about this problem and it looks like they wont be updating a new driver for Vista users.
Should i try to downgrade my laptop from Vista to XP in order to get the printer working? or any other options?

You can install Windows XP on a virtual machine like VMware, or virtual box. It is pretty easy to do. you just need 10+ GB of free space on your Hard drive. There are plenty of tutorials on Virtualbox, and VMware online.
